Player Story

Quez Watkins story

Quez Watkins built his college career from 2017 through 2019 as a wide receiver from Athens, AL wearing No. 16, spending time with Southern Miss. The clearest part of Quez Watkins' career was his receiving role: 160 catches, 2,411 receiving yards, 17 touchdowns, and 12 rushing yards across 34 career games in the available record. His career also includes 12 rushing yards, 5 tackles, and 543 return yards, giving the story more than a single-category snapshot.
